Mountie Lines Up Behind Prohibited Driver At West Kelowna Drive-Thru, Makes Arrest

Darpan News Desk, 05 Mar, 2020 08:22 PM

    A West Kelowna RCMP officer was waiting in line at the drive through of a local coffee shop just before 2:30 am on March 1st, 2020 when she discovered that the vehicle she was behind had been reported stolen on February 28th in Edmonton.


    West Kelowna front line officers were able to surround the vehicle and the driver was taken into custody without incident.


    During the arrest, it was determined that the man had two outstanding warrants from Merritt for driving while prohibited, and was currently a prohibited driver.


    39-year-old Peter Hancock is facing charges of prohibited driving and possession of stolen property. He currently remains in custody.
